Douglas College is the largest public degree-granting college institution in British Columbia, Canada. Close to 17,000 credit students, 8,500 continuing education students and 4,210 international students are enrolled here

What is the Annual Cost of attendance at Douglas College?
The annual cost of attendance for international students at Douglas College typically includes tuition fees of approximately CAD 18,000 and living expenses around CAD 12,000, totaling CAD 30,000. Converted to Indian Rupees, this amounts to approximately INR 17,40,000 (based on the current exchange rate of 1 CAD = 58 INR).
What Financial aid and scholarship options are available at Douglas College?
Douglas College offers a range of scholarships and bursaries for international students. These include merit-based scholarships, athletic scholarships, and awards based on community involvement. Students can apply through the Douglas College website by submitting an online application form, which includes providing academic transcripts and a personal statement.

What are the housing options at Douglas College?
Douglas College does not have on-campus housing, but there are many off-campus housing options available nearby. Popular areas for student accommodation include New Westminster, Coquitlam, and Surrey. These areas offer a range of rental options from shared apartments to private suites, providing students with choices that fit various budgets and preferences.
